METHOD FOR OBTAINING CLOSTRIDIUM OEDEMATIENS TOXIN

Abstract

The method of obtaining Clostridium Oedematiens toxin by means of culturing a nutritive medium based on liver water, pepsin and pancreatic hydrolyzates of casein, is distinguished by the fact that, with the aim of increasing the yield of toxin, cultures for seeding are selected with the help of luminescent microscopy and 3% dextrin and 0.3% porolon or wood sawdust are added to the medium.
